How Our Residential Water Removal Service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. We understand that every minute counts with water damage, which is why we focus on rapid response times and thorough communication throughout the process.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team assesses the damage and creates a customized plan to address the issue. This includes identifying the source of the water, evaluating the extent of the damage, and developing a strategy for restoration.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use specialized equipment to extract the water from your home,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and promoting a safe environment for our technicians to work in.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We employ advanced drying techniques such as using desiccants and air movers, to dry your home efficiently.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as, including walls, floors, and personal belongings. This step is essential in preventing the growth of mold and bacteria, which can pose serious health risks.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

We work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, or cabinets.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al

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s essential to catch the signs early to prevent more extensive damage. Here are some warning signs you need residential water remov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Visible water stains can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s crucial to address the problem before it escalates.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age. If you notice your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.

Discolored or Fuzzy Carpet

Discolored or fuzzy carpet can show water damage. If you notice your carpet is discolored or fuzzy,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.

Visible Mold or Mildew

Visible mold or mildew can pose serious health risks. If you notice visible mold or mildew in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ly and safely.

Residential Water Removal Cost in South Cole, ID

The cost of residential water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in South Cole, ID.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of residential water removal: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of drying process
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required, and equipment needed
Restoration and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and materials required

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. Our team will provide a free estimate and work with you to develop a customized plan to address the issue.

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Regular maintenance is key to preventing water damage. Our team recommends checking your home’s plumbing, appliances, and roof regularly to identify potential issues before they become major problems. Also, consider installing a sump pump or backup power source to prevent flooding during power outages.
